1. What is a Door Gasket?
A door gasket is a versatile, often rubber or foam strip that seals the edges of a door when it is closed. Its main function is to develop an airtight or watertight seal between the door and the frame, preventing the escape of air, moisture, and impurities. Gaskets are commonly found in:

Step-by-StepGuide to Replacing a Door Gasket Changing a door gasket is a simple procedurethat can be made with very little tools. Follow these steps: Materials Needed: New
door
gasket Screwdriver
(if relevant)Scissors(for
trimming)Cleaning
fabric Adhesive(if
essential)Procedure: Remove the
Old Gasket:
Start by unlocking
and checking the old gasket. Eliminate it carefully, either by peeling it off or unscrewing it from its
position. Tidy the
Surface: Wipe down the location where the gasket was connected utilizing a cleansing fabric. Remove any residue or particles to
ensure a strong bond for the brand-new gasket. Step and Cut: Measure
the length of the door frame and cut the brand-new gasket accordingly. Make certain to leave a little extra length if needed
to ensure a snug fit
- . Set up the New
- Gasket: Begin at one corner and press the new gasket into location. If the gasket requires adhesive, apply it before pushing. Make certain it's lined up
properly with no twists* **or gaps. Secure the Gasket(if required):
* Some gaskets may need screws or clips for added security. Make sure these are tightened however not overly so, as this may compress the gasket excessive.
**
Evaluate the Seal:
- Close the door and check for any spaces where air can get away. You can use a paper to evaluate the tightness of the seal.
*If it pulls out easily, the gasket might need adjustment. 5. Maintenance Tips to Prolong Gasket Life To make sure the durability of a recently set up door gasket, comply with the following upkeep
